The Pakistan Cricket Board has offered to consider a hybrid model, which is an important step towards breaking the impasse over the 2025 Champions Trophy. For this, the PCB has laid down the condition that this option should be proceeded with even when a global tournament is held in India. For this, the PCB has said to accept this option under a written agreement.
PCB has proposed this in meetings it had with ICC and BCCI over the weekend in Dubai. They have sought a uniform and long-term deal applicable beyond the 2025 Champions Trophy, under which they will also be given the right to play outside India during international events.
It is not yet clear whether this will be for the next three years or till the end of the current rights cycle (2031).
3 major Men’s global tournaments till 2031 along with the Champions Trophy
During this period, India will host three men’s global tournaments – the 2026 T20 World Cup (co-hosted with Sri Lanka), the 2029 Champions Trophy, and the 2031 World Cup (co-hosted with Bangladesh) – besides hosting the women’s World Cup in 2025. Co-hosting may be a way out, but India-Pakistan matches will remain an issue.
Also, it is not within the purview of the ICC. The Asia Cup for 2025 will again be played in India. That one will also take place in October next year.
“We will do whatever is in the best interest of cricket. If another formula has to be followed, it will be followed in a fair manner. The only important thing for Pakistan is dignity. Everything else comes afterward,” PCB chairman Mohsin Naqvi told journalists in Dubai on Sunday.
“A one-sided arrangement is no longer acceptable. It cannot be that we keep going to India but they do not come to Pakistan. Whatever happens will be on the basis of equality.”
The BCCI, however, has remained mum on the issue. It would appear that they are not keen on adopting a hybrid model for their tournaments. In any case, the ICC board will examine the PCB’s proposal and make a final decision on the Champions Trophy. Both the PCB and BCCI will have to get the decision approved by their respective governments. The ICC has set December 5 as the tentative date for this meeting.
The options for the tournament remain the same as they were during the meeting held last week: either the tournament based on a hybrid model, with India playing its matches outside Pakistan; or the entire tournament will be held in another country, or the tournament will go ahead without India.
It was decided that the PCB would be given time to hold separate talks with the BCCI in order to find a solution in the last meeting. The BCCI had told the ICC that the Indian government had not given permission for the team to travel to Pakistan. Last Friday, a spokesperson for the Indian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) said that India was not keen on traveling to Pakistan due to “security concerns“. is.
“The BCCI has issued a statement, I would suggest you look at the same. They have said that there are security concerns there and hence it is unlikely that the team will go there. Please refer to the statement issued by the BCCI,” the spokesperson said during the press briefing.
The BCCI has not come out in the open with such a statement. According to the PCB, it had asked for an official clarification as to why the Indian team is not traveling but it hasn’t received any reply yet.
How long will it take to confirm the Champions Trophy model?
After the first ICC meeting, there has been a massive change in the ICC. Jay Shah, who was BCCI secretary since 2019, took over as ICC chairman on December 1. Imran Khwaja, ICC vice-chairman, has been handling the Champions Trophy issue as interim chairman. However, it is not confirmed who will represent BCCI at the next ICC board meeting.
This meeting is widely believed to be centered on the Champions Trophy. However, it has also been suggested that this could be a formal call for the start of Shah’s tenure.
Time is slipping away quite fast. The ICC has had only 77 days to the start of this tournament, and now it does face a bit of a hard situation.
